The formula for cellular respiration is C6H12O6 + 6 O2 yields 6 CO2 + 6H2O + energyin the form of ATP. If you count the number of reacting atoms in the reaction thereare 6 carbon atoms, 12 hydrogen atoms, and 18 oxygen atoms. The products alsoyield 6 carbon atoms, 12 hydrogen atoms, and 18 oxygen atoms. This means the lawof conservation of matter is followed EXCEPT for the energy part. How is energyderived without losing or gaining atoms?
